Output 51673a7e544e62ccfdd78fa3b1b4cd92dc8fff2a1f750bc9840e229dce242e92:1

value
22197284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c63aa678cb7419388c4f88ad068efd0b4ca9bc56 OP_EQUAL
address
MRyJHWGwKDbnpueeSjVGGPW1kLUxFHkQpV
transaction
51673a7e544e62ccfdd78fa3b1b4cd92dc8fff2a1f750bc9840e229dce242e92
spent
true